MSPs of this type typically handle day-to-day IT operations for small and mid-sized businesses. Common offerings may include network monitoring, patch management, and basic endpoint protection, but the depth of security services can vary significantly from one provider to another.

Threat protection is a broad category, and not every MSP delivers the same level of coverage. Some focus on reactive support, while others prioritize proactive defenses like firewall management, intrusion prevention, and vulnerability management.

When evaluating Complete Network or any similar provider, the key is to ask about specific security outcomes. Inquire about their incident response process, whether they offer 24/7 monitoring, and how they handle ransomware defense or zero-day exploit scenarios. Clear answers matter more than marketing language when comparing managed security services.

Effective threat monitoring requires more than watching for obvious signs of attack. It requires collecting and analyzing data from across your network. Charlotte IT Solutions uses a data-driven approach to IT, meaning decisions and responses are based on actual system information. This includes security information and event management, or SIEM, along with log analysis as part of its managed security services.

SIEM and log analysis allow security teams to detect patterns that might indicate an intrusion. Unusual login times, unexpected data transfers, or repeated failed access attempts can signal a problem. Without these tools, threats can remain hidden for weeks or months.
